摘要: A nanodiamond according to the present invention has acidic functional groups, contains the acidic functional groups in a number density of 1 or more per square nanometer in the nanodiamond surface, and has a specific surface area of 150 m2/g or more. Particles of the nanodiamond preferably have a D50 (median diameter) of 9 nm or less. The nanodiamond is preferably derived from a nanodiamond synthesized by a detonation technique (in particular, an air-cooling detonation technique).

摘要: Acetic acid is produced by oxidation of methane with an oxygen-containing gas in the presence of an acid selected from concentrated sulfuric acid and fuming sulfuric acid, a palladium-containing catalyst and a promoter, preferably a copper or iron salt. The addition of a promoter and O2 to a system that includes a palladium-containing catalyst such as PdCl2 increases the rate of acetic acid formation from methane by more than an order of magnitude as compared with prior art and, in addition, inhibits the precipitation of Pd black.

摘要: The present invention is directed to a process of oxidizing organic compounds having benzylic carbon atoms. The process of this invention comprises reacting an organic compound having one or more benzylic carbon atoms with an effective amount of an effective oxidizing agent in water at a temperature equal to or greater than about 350.degree. C. and at a pressure equal to or greater than about 175 atmospheres, wherein said agent is selected from the group consisting of a combination of one or more bases and one or more of elemental sulfur, an oxidized form of elemental sulfur and/or an organic or inorganic sulfur containing compounds capable of forming elemental sulfur, said oxidized forms or a combination thereof in situ under process conditions, and organic or inorganic compounds which form one or more bases and elemental sulfur, oxidized forms of sulfur or a combination thereof in situ under process conditions.
